I always receive e-mails regarding E-Harmony's Free Communication Weekends. This particular event lasts from today until August 1st, so I decided to update my profile and my pictures and take advantage of it. And yes, I figured it would be good blog fodder regardless.

The top of the page has an advertisement letting us know that "Cassondra and Jeff first met during a Free Communication Weekend". But no pressure, folks. During the survey, I was asked four times if I knew anyone who married as a result of E-Harmony. Once again, no pressure.


The first thing I noticed was that out of the 6 matches provided to me, 3 were geographically undesirable in spite of my preference that matches live within 30 miles of me.

Next, unpaid members cannot see pictures. We're expected to try to communicate based on a very vague description.
